Kathleen Adell Bridges England

March 16, 1985 — November 7, 2023

Mansfield, Texas

Kathleen “Katie” England, wife, mother, daughter, Gigi, niece, cousin, aunt, sister-in law, and friend went to eternal rest on November 7, 2023.

Katie was born to Monty Bridges and Carolee Martchenke Bridges on March 16, 1985. Katie grew up in Mansfield, TX on a road surrounded by her cousins. Katie was 11 months older than her best friend and brother, Blake. They were inseparable and shared the strongest of sibling bonds. Katie and Blake had many mischievous adventures and even more laughs. Katie graduated from Waxahachie High School in 2003 where she participated in choir and HOSA (Health Occupations Students of America). Her favorite summers were spent attending an all-girl, faith-based retreat, Camp Loma Linda.

In 2008 Katie married Ernest “Ernie” Roy England. They continued to live in Mansfield and recently purchased a home on that familiar road still enriched with family. Katie’s greatest loves were her daughters, Elizabeth and Ellie, son Hunter and grandson Robbie. Katie enjoyed sharing the joy of her daughters and encouraged each of them in their own hobbies of band, orchestra, art, track, flag football, and cheerleading. Katie was proud of her son, Hunter, now stationed in England as a US Air Force E-4/Senior Airman. Katie showed off pictures of her grandson Robbie to all her friends and family at any chance she had. Together with her family Katie attended church at First Methodist Mansfield.

Katie had a tremendous work ethic. She worked at RF Installations for 15 years where she learned the business and excelled quickly. Soon she was known as the “go to” person and served as the organization’s Operations Manager. Since April 2022 Kaite held multiple roles supporting National Operations and Procurement initiatives for Invitation Homes.

Whether working her raised garden beds or maintaining her many bird feeders, Katie enjoyed anything associated with nature. She loved fishing and making family memories in Lake City, Colorado, and Lake Whitney. The family always looked forward to the jeopardy games Katie organized at Christmas, complete with pictures, music, and family trivia. She was an avid Texas Longhorns and Texas Rangers fan; her grandfathers wouldn’t have it any other way. Katie’s commitment and passion for supporting others was a true gift and will be greatly missed.

She is survived by her father, Monty Bridges, her mother, Carolee Bridges, her husband, Ernie England, her daughters, Elizabeth and Ellie, her son Hunter, her grandson Robbie England, and Grandmother Carolyn Martchenke. She will be dearly missed by all her family as their bonds of love are immeasurable.

Katie was preceded in death by her brother Blake Bridges, Father-in-law Robert England, Grandparents Helen and Jim Bridges, Grandfather Patrick Martchenke, and Uncle Steve Martchenke.
